body{font-family:Arial,sans-serif;background-color:#f4f4f9;margin:0;padding:20px;transition:background-color .3s,color .3s}h1{text-align:center;color:#333}#nav-list{list-style-type:none;padding:0;display:flex;flex-wrap:wrap;justify-content:center}#nav-list li{background-color:#f9f9f9;color:#333;border:1px solid #ddd;border-radius:8px;margin:10px;padding:15px;width:200px;box-shadow:0 2px 4px #0000001a;transition:transform .2s,background-color .3s;text-align:center;cursor:pointer}#nav-list li:hover{background-color:#fff}#nav-list a{text-decoration:none;color:inherit;display:block}#nav-list p{font-size:.9em;color:#666;margin:0}#tag-cloud{display:block;max-width:220px;overflow-wrap:break-word}.tag-button{margin:5px;padding:8px 12px;border:none;border-radius:20px;background-color:#007bff33;color:#007bff;box-shadow:0 2px 4px #0003;cursor:pointer;transition:background-color .3s,transform .2s;text-align:center}.tag-button.active{background-color:#007bff80;color:#fff}.tag-button:hover{background-color:#007bff4d;transform:scale(1.05)}#clear-selection{margin:5px;padding:8px 12px;border:none;border-radius:20px;background-color:#ff00004d;color:red;cursor:pointer;transition:background-color .3s,transform .2s}#clear-selection:hover{background-color:#ff000080;transform:scale(1.05)}.sidebar{position:fixed;top:0;left:0;width:250px;height:100%;background-color:#f8f9fa;overflow-x:hidden;overflow-y:hidden;transition:width .3s;z-index:1000}.sidebar:hover{overflow-y:auto}.sidebar-content{max-height:calc(100vh - 20px);overflow-y:auto;scrollbar-width:none}.sidebar-content::-webkit-scrollbar{display:none}.toggle-button,.toggle-sidebar{margin:10px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}.toggle-button:hover,.toggle-sidebar:hover{background-color:#0056b3;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}.toggle-button:active,.toggle-sidebar:active{background-color:#004494;box-shadow:0 2px 4px #0003;transform:translateY(0)}.tag-cloud{text-align:left;margin:20px;max-width:220px;overflow-wrap:break-word}.clear-selection{margin-left:10px}.toggle-sidebar{display:block;position:absolute;top:10px;left:260px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;padding:10px 20px;font-size:16px}.nav-list{margin-left:270px}.sidebar-button{display:block;width:100%;margin:10px 0;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}.sidebar-button:hover{background-color:#0056b3;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}.file-input-container{width:100%;margin:10px 0;display:flex;flex-direction:column;align-items:flex-start}.file-input-container input[type=file]{width:100%;cursor:pointer}.file-input-wrapper{width:100%;display:flex;justify-content:center;margin:10px 0}.file-input-wrapper button,.file-input-wrapper input[type=file]{width:100%;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;text-align:center;transition:background-color .3s}.file-input-wrapper button:hover,.file-input-wrapper input[type=file]:hover{background-color:#0056b3}.file-input-wrapper.full-view{display:block}.file-input-wrapper.icon-view,.file-input-wrapper input[type=file]{display:none}.file-input-wrapper button{background-color:#0056b3;color:#fff;border:none;border-radius:5px;padding:5px 10px;cursor:pointer;margin-bottom:5px}.file-input-wrapper span{margin-top:5px}#nav-list a div{white-space:nowrap;overflow:hidden;text-overflow:ellipsis;max-width:180px;display:inline-block}.icon-view{background-color:#add8e6;border:none;color:#fff;font-size:24px;padding:10px;margin:5px;border-radius:8px;cursor:pointer;display:flex;align-items:center;justify-content:center;transition:background-color .3s}.icon-view:hover{background-color:#87ceeb}.sidebar-button:active,.toggle-button:active,.icon-view:active{background-color:#004494;box-shadow:0 2px 4px #0003;transform:translateY(0)}#bookmark-display{margin-left:270px;transition:margin-left .3s}.reset-button{background-color:red;color:#fff}.reset-button:hover{background-color:#c00}.export-button{background-color:#add8e6;color:#333;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}.export-button:hover{background-color:#87ceeb;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}.nav-list-item{position:relative;margin-bottom:10px;padding:10px;border-radius:4px;transition:all .3s ease;background-color:#fff}.nav-list-link{display:block;text-decoration:none}.nav-list-title{font-weight:700;color:#007bff;transition:color .3s ease}.nav-list-description{font-size:.9em;color:#666;margin-bottom:20px}.nav-list-tag-container{position:absolute;bottom:10px;right:10px;display:none;flex-wrap:wrap;gap:5px}.nav-list-item:hover .nav-list-tag-container{display:flex}.nav-list-item:hover .nav-list-title{color:#0056b3}.nav-list-item:hover .nav-list-tag-container span{background-color:#d0d0d0;color:#000}.github-link{position:fixed;top:20px;right:20px;z-index:1000}.github-icon{font-size:24px;color:#333;transition:color .3s ease}.github-link:hover .github-icon{color:#007bff}.hidden{display:none}.other-button{background-color:#add8e6;color:#333;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}.other-button:hover{background-color:#87ceeb;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}#reset-bookmarks-other{background-color:red;color:#fff;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}#reset-bookmarks-other:hover{background-color:#c00;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}#merge-bookmarks{background-color:#add8e6;color:#333;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}#merge-bookmarks:hover{background-color:#87ceeb;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}#export-options{background-color:#add8e6;color:#333;border:none;border-radius:8px;cursor:pointer;text-align:center;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003;position:relative;overflow:hidden}#export-options:hover{background-color:#87ceeb;box-shadow:0 4px 8px #0000004d;transform:translateY(-2px)}.button-group{display:flex;justify-content:space-between}.button-group .sidebar-button,.button-group .toggle-button{flex:1;margin:5px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;transition:background-color .3s}.delete-icon{position:absolute;top:5px;right:5px;width:20px;height:20px;background-color:red;color:#fff;border-radius:50%;display:flex;align-items:center;justify-content:center;cursor:pointer;font-size:14px;line-height:1;transition:background-color .3s}.delete-icon:hover{background-color:#8b0000}body.dark-mode{background-color:#2e2e2e;color:#fff}.theme-toggle{position:fixed;top:20px;right:60px;z-index:1001;font-size:24px;cursor:pointer;transition:color .3s}.sidebar.dark-mode{background-color:#3e3e3e}body.dark-mode .tag-button{background-color:#555;color:#fff}body.dark-mode .nav-list-description{color:#fff}#nav-list li.dark-mode{background-color:#4e4e4e;color:#fff}.tag-button{background-color:#555;color:#fff}.tag-button:hover{background-color:#0056b3;color:#fff}body.dark-mode #nav-list li{background-color:#1a1a1a;color:#fff}body.dark-mode #nav-list li:hover{background-color:#555}body.dark-mode .tag-button:hover{background-color:#555;color:#fff}.header{display:flex;align-items:center;justify-content:space-between;margin-bottom:20px}h1{font-size:2em;font-weight:700;color:#333;margin:0}.toggle-button{position:absolute;top:10px;left:250px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:8px;cursor:pointer;transition:background-color .3s,box-shadow .3s,transform .3s;box-shadow:0 2px 4px #0003}.toggle-tags-button{display:inline-block;margin:5px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;transition:background-color .3s,transform .3s}.toggle-tags-button:hover{background-color:#0056b3;transform:translateY(-2px)}.sidebar-button,.toggle-tags-button{display:inline-block;width:100px;height:40px;margin:5px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;text-align:center;transition:background-color .3s}.sidebar-button:hover,.toggle-tags-button:hover{background-color:#0056b3}body.dark-mode .tag-button{background-color:#1a1a1a;color:#fff}body:not(.dark-mode) .tag-button{background-color:#f9f9f9;color:#333}.icon-red{color:#333}body.dark-mode .icon-red{color:#fff}#other-options{width:100%;margin:10px 0;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;text-align:center;transition:background-color .3s}.other-button{flex:1 0 100%;margin:5px 0;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;transition:background-color .3s}#other-menu{display:flex;flex-wrap:wrap;margin:10px 0}.other-button{flex:0 1 calc(50% - 10px);margin:5px;padding:10px;background-color:#007bff;color:#fff;border:none;border-radius:5px;cursor:pointer;transition:background-color .3s}.other-button:hover{background-color:#0056b3}.sidebar.collapsed .sidebar-button{display:none}.icon-view{display:block}.sidebar.collapsed .icon-view{display:inline-block}.header{display:flex;align-items:center;justify-content:center;margin-bottom:20px}.header h1{margin:0;color:#333;text-align:center;font-size:2em}
